## Step 4: Confirm SDK Parity Before Deploy

Welcome aboard! Before shipping a Fernwick release, make sure the Kestrel (mobile) and Bramble (web) SDKs expose the same surface — run the parity checker and eyeball the diff report. If Bramble is missing a method, don't ship; flag it in the team channel instead. Once parity passes, tag the release and sign both bundles. The signer script will prompt you, so paste in the release signing key shown below.

signing key of bagap-yawep = bky13_TbfT6ZMUoGJo2

# Provenance: Squatwatch Scanner Builds

Squatwatch, our typo-squatting package scanner, now ships only from the sealed Ironquay pipeline. No local builds. Each artifact carries a signed manifest: source rev, builder, dependency lockset. Release manager: reject anything lacking attestation. Verification is one command against the manifest. The current approved release corresponds to the token recorded immediately below.

trace token, fafog-kageg: htk4_98e6

**Action Item 2 — Consent banner rollout guardrails.** The Willowmere banner shipped to 100% before the dismissal-tracking fix landed, which is how we double-counted opt-outs for a week. Going forward, ramps stay gated on the metrics check, no exceptions. Future maintainers: the rollout thresholds live in config, and the current values are below.

constants for hahof-bajep:
THRESHOLDS = {
    "sorwyn": 797,
    "jorath": 933,
    "pramir": 998,
    "wenath": 950,
    "silok": 489,
    "prawyn": 572,
    "praiel": 821,
}